The postcode WA13 0DP is located in Warrington It was introduced in January 1980 and is an active postcode. WA13 0DP is a small user postcode that may contain upto 100 addresses (but 15 is more typical).

WA13 0DP is one of the least deprived areas in the country. It rates as a 8.3 on the scale of the index of deprivation (where 10 are the least deprived and 0 are the most deprived areas). The 2011 UK census classified the residents of WA13 0DP as Urbanites > Urban professionals and families > White professionals.

The closest road name to WA13 0DP is Newfield Road which is centered 68 m away.

The nearest bus stop is Barsbank Lane and is 45 m away.

The closest primary school to WA13 0DP (for ages 11 and under) is Cherry Tree Primary School. It achieved an OFSTED rating of Outstanding on April 22, 2010. The closest secondary school (for ages 11-18) is Lymm High School. The last OFSTED inspection on February 6, 2018 rated this school as Good

The local pub for residents of WA13 0DP is Crown Inn and is 207 m away. The Food Standards Agency (FSA) rated it as Very Good on November 27, 2019. The nearest takeaway food is available from Forage Box and is 507 m distant. The FSA rated this establishment as Good on November 17, 2021.

Residents reported an average download speed of 33.7 Mbps and an average upload speed of 6.1 Mbps in a 2017 OFCOM broadband survey. 100% of residents have broadband access of ultrafast 300+ Mbps. 100% of residents have broadband access of superfast 30-300 Mbps.

Gas consumption for the area is rated at 2.2 out of 10. Electricity consumption for the area is rated at 0.6 out of 10. Where 0 are the lowest and 10 are the highest consuming areas in the country respectively.

Policing for WA13 0DP is covered by the Cheshire police force association and Warrington is the NHS Primary Care Trust (PCT) or Care Trust Plus (CT).
